[חֲגָוִים] noun masculine plural places of concealment, retreats, as abode of dove יוֺנָתִי בְּחַגְוֵי הַסֶּלַע Song 2:14 (in metaphor); also hyperbole, as abode of Edom (ה)סלע ׳ שֹׁכְנִּי בח Jer 49:16; Obad 1:3.

| Strong's Number: | H2288 |
|---|---|
| Word: | חֲגָו |
| Part of Speech: | noun masc |
| Etymology: | from an unused root meaning to take refuge |
| Language: | Hebrew |
| Occurrences: | 3 |
| Transliteration: | chagav |
| Phonetic Spelling/Pronunciation: | khag-awv' |
| Meaning: | 1. a rift in rocks |
| KJV Renderings: | cleft. |
